Setting Up a New Toilet Flange:
When mounting a new toilet flange, the primary step is to pick the right replacement for your plumbing arrangement. Take into consideration factors such as the material of the flange, with options including PVC, ABS, or cast iron. PVC flanges are known for their affordability and resistance to corrosion, making them a prominent option for DIY lovers. Abdominal flanges use similar benefits to PVC but brag included durability, making them ideal for high-traffic locations or industrial settings. Cast iron flanges, renowned for their toughness and durability, are optimal for installations where toughness is extremely important. Furthermore, guarantee that the substitute flange is effectively sized and fits well into place to produce a watertight seal and prevent leaks.
Securing the Flange to the Floor:
As soon as you've selected the right substitute flange, it's vital to protect it correctly to the flooring to ensure stability and stop future concerns. Begin by placing and lining up the flange appropriately over the drain, making sure that it sits flush with the flooring surface area. Depending upon the kind of flange and your specific installation choices, you can safeguard the flange to the floor using screws or adhesive. If using screws, be sure to use corrosion-resistant options to prevent rusting in time. Additionally, adhesive can offer a safe and secure bond between the flange and the floor, making sure a strong and reliable installment. By adhering to these actions and taking the needed preventative measures, you can mount a brand-new toilet flange with confidence, ensuring a durable and leak-free plumbing fixture.

Types of Toilet Flanges:
Comprehending the various kinds of toilet flanges is necessary for choosing one of the most suitable choice for your plumbing requires. PVC, ABS, and cast iron are amongst the common materials used in bathroom flange building, each offering unique advantages and factors to consider. PVC flanges, known for their cost and rust resistance, are favoured for their convenience of installation and resilience. ABS flanges, comparable to PVC in regards to price and convenience of installment, are treasured for their toughness and resistance to effects. On the other hand, cast iron flanges, renowned for their outstanding stamina and longevity, are frequently preferred for high-traffic locations or industrial settings where longevity is vital. By familiarising on your own with the qualities of each product, you can make a notified choice when choosing a toilet flange that aligns with your details demands and choices.
In addition to product considerations, toilet flanges likewise come in numerous design and styles to accommodate different plumbing arrangements and setup choices. Offset flanges, for example, are created to accommodate bathrooms set up on floors that are uneven or where the drain is located off-centre. Likewise, repair work flanges, likewise referred to as fixing rings or spacer rings, are utilized to attend to problems such as cracked or damaged flanges without the demand for substantial plumbing adjustments. Furthermore, adjustable flanges provide flexibility in positioning, enabling precise alignment and fit throughout setup. By exploring the varied variety of toilet flange kinds and designs readily available, you can select the option that finest suits your plumbing arrangement and installation needs, guaranteeing a smooth and trusted service for your washroom fixtures.

TOILET REPAIR HOW TO REPLACE A BROKEN TOILET FLANGE
First remove the toilet. Turn off the water line, flush the toilet, and remove the water line from the bottom of the toilet tank. Have bucket handy, as water will come out of the tank. Sponge out as much water from the tank and bowl as you can. A handyman trick is to use a wet dry shop vac to suck all the water out of the bowl and tank.
Remove the nuts on each side of the base of the toilet. These nuts-bolts attach the toilet to the flange. You may have to use a saw to cut the nuts off, which is ok, because you are going to put in new toilet bolts and nuts. The flange, when brand new, is attached to the waste pipe. Many times it rusts or snaps off. Tilt the toilet on its side and move out of the way. Have a helper assist you in moving the toilet, they are heavy and bulky.
Use a putty knife to remove the wax ring residue from the exposed flange and inspect the flange and surrounding area. What is key here is if the wood subfloor is rotted. If this is the case, you will have to cut out the surrounding subfloor and replace it with new plywood, then fix the flange.
Thankfully on this home improvement project, the subfloor was fine, just the flange fell apart. Go to your hardware store and buy a Super Ring Replacement Toilet Ring. There are several models by different suppliers, don't buy the cheapest one, its your toilet, remember...
Also at the hardware store buy new toilet mounting bolts, they usually come in a package with the nuts and washers.
Put the toilet mounting bolts in the flange pointing up, and use some wax from the old wax ring to hold them in place. Place the super ring replacement toilet ring over the waste line, making sure the mounting bolts are in the same place as the original bolts were, one bolt on each side of the flange.
Screw the new flange into the subfloor. You may have to use a hammer drill to drill through existing tile flooring or cement substrate. Set the new toilet wax ring onto the flange on the base of the toilet, and guide the toilet back onto the super ring, making sure the toilet mounting bolts are lined up with the mount holes in the toilet base. The super ring toilet ring allows for you to adjust the location of the bolts.
